Job Summary
The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) will participate in the
implementation and evaluation of patient care, under the
supervision of a registered nurse, advanced practice provider, or
physician. The Medical Assistant (CMA) functions within the
administration pre-defined scope of practice guidelines per state
location of practice. LPN: The LPN ensures the health, comfort and
safety of patients. The LPN documents a thorough medical history
from patient. Contributes to the assessment of patients and
administers medications or treatments as ordered. The LPN provides
technical support to healthcare professionals as needed. Counseling
patients and family members, under the direction of a registered
nurse, on prevention and treatment plans. The LPN demonstrates
competency and practices within the full scope of nursing
expertise/knowledge and utilizes appropriate age and population
specific standards as designated in their assigned clinical
setting.
CMA: The CMA in the ambulatory care setting collects subjective and
objective health status data from the patient or caregiver and
communicates this data to the health care provider. The CMA
participates in the care of patients by providing contributing data
to licensed health care professionals; and following through on the
patient's plan of care under the direction of the provider.
Communicates the provider's written instructions for care to the
patient, or caregiver, by transmission of specifically defined
information. The CMA will participate in care for patients, across
the lifespan, in all phases of preventative care, health
maintenance, treatment, and follow-up as patients move in and out
of care settings. The CMA performs a variety of duties under the
direct supervision of a person licensed to practice medicine. A
sampling of the specialized clinical duties performed includes, but
is not limited to, obtaining vital signs, preparing patients for
examinations, observing and reporting patient's signs or symptoms,
and performing point of care testing.
Qualifications
LPN: Must have graduated from a school or college of nursing
program leading to licensure as a Licensed Practical Nurse.
Associate's degree in practical nursing is preferred.
Specific services/positions may have additional education, training
or experience requirements. Must have attended a pre-licensure
nursing program that included supervised clinical experience across
the life span as part of the curriculum or have had a minimum of
400 hours of experience as a RN (or LPN) at another facility.
Requires current licensure as a practical nurse in the state/states
of practice.
CMA: Must be a graduate of a recognized Medical Assistant
program.
Prior experience in a healthcare setting is preferred.
Nationally certified or registered as a Medical Assistant (MA).
Certification (CMA) obtained through a nationally approved
certification program for medical assistant, including but not
limited to: American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A),
Certified Clinical Medical Assistant (CCMA) through the National
HealthCareer Association (NHA), Clinical Medical Assistant
Certification (CMAC) through the American Medical Certification
Association (AMCA), or National Certified Medical Assistant (NCMA)
through the National Center for Competency Testing (NCCT), etc.
Registration (RMA) obtained through the American Medical
Technologists (AMT) also acceptable. Additional state requirements
include: North Dakota (ND) registration as an MAIII through the ND
Board of Nursing. MAs working within Minnesota (MN), Iowa (IA),
South Dakota (SD) and Oregon (OR) do not require state
registration.
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required within six months
of employment. Re-certification as required.
